The Secret Sauce in AZEK Boards
Peek under the hood and you’ll find something cool: about 80% recycled stuff like plastic bags and wood fibers, all glued together with space-age polymers. It’s like Mother Nature and NASA had a baby. The magic happens in the protective cap layer – this thin shield fights UV rays better than your SPF 100 beach sunscreen. Pro tip: The scratch-resistant surface handles patio furniture drags like a champ. I once saw a contractor accidentally drop a toolbox full of wrenches on an AZEK board – not a single dent.

The Money Talk
Okay, let’s address the elephant in the yard: AZEK composite decking material costs more upfront than pressure-treated pine. But here’s the kicker – you’re saving about 75% on maintenance over 10 years. No more $300 annual staining sessions or replacing rotten boards every 3-5 years. My client Sarah calculated she’ll break even in 7 years… then keep saving while her neighbors play deck repair roulette.
Keeping It Fresh Without the Hassle
Maintenance is stupid simple – just soapy water and a soft brush. The grooved boards hide dirt better than your teenager’s bedroom floor. For stubborn spots? A magic eraser works wonders. Unlike wood, you’ll never need to sand out stains or re-seal cracks. Honestly, the hardest part is remembering to actually clean it since it stays looking good on its own.
Green Cred You Can Brag About
With certifications like GREENGUARD Gold and 80%+ recycled content, AZEK composite decking material lets you flex your eco-warrior side. Every 100 sq ft installed keeps about 2,000 plastic bags out of oceans. Plus, no toxic chemicals leaching into your garden – your tomatoes will thank you.
